Electrical Planner Scheduler

New Zealand Steel | Waikato North Head Mine Site | Full-time, Permanent

New Zealand Steel, a wholly owned subsidiary of BlueScope, is a leading manufacturer and marketer of flat rolled steel products, servicing the building, construction, manufacturing, and agricultural sectors. You might know us best for our iconicCOLORSTEEL®brand.

We currently have apermanent opportunityavailable within theWaikato North Head Maintenance teamfor an experiencedElectrical Planner Scheduler

About the Role

This role is based at ourWaikato North Head Mine Site, located onGhezzie Road, Otaua. It is afull-time position,Monday to Friday, and some overtime as required.

Reporting to theWNH Maintenance Superintendent, the Electrical Planner Scheduler plays a crucial role in coordinating and preparing maintenance work. You’ll be responsible for planning and scheduling maintenance activities from a project management perspective—establishing sequences, procuring necessary parts, and ensuring resources are available before work begins.

From time to time, this role will also provide coverage for thePME Team Leaderand other Maintenance Planner Scheduler roles within the team.
